SANGUEM: The BJP workers have expressed displeasure over the removal of Navnath Naik as the BJP Sanguem block president.
Naik mentioned during the press briefing that the party’s state president Sadanand Tanawade has contacted him and said that he will be promoted and will be given bigger responsibility.”
Speaking further, Navnath Naik said that in 2012, when they walked around the constituency with Vasudev Gaokar and Subhash Phal Desai, why didn’t today’s leaders take action against us as they took anti-party action.
“No one has a right to remove someone as a party worker, as what president said that I am removed. It is our role to make the party bigger in difficult situations,” he said.
“Subhash Phal Desai had joined BJP from Congress; now, we are questioning for the candidature of Savitri Kavalekar, at present she is on the post as State Vice President of BJP Mahila Morcha. Seeing this action, BJP has become a party of Desai community party,” alleged Naik.
He said the party cannot take decisions arbitrarily.
“Why is the BJP ticket being given back only to Subhash Phal Desai, who lost the last election?” Naik questioned.
He further said that he has been with party for last
17 years and does not need to prove the party loyalty.
“We have given sweat and blood for the party work, now someone is teaching us what is right and loyalty of the party,” he said.
ST Morcha president Mahesh Gaokar said that the party was ignoring karyakartas for just one man.
“Keeping in mind, we are working to bring together the old party workers,” he said.
“If you give a ticket to anyone other than Savitri Kavalekar, the party will lose the workers,” he said.
He said that what Manohar Parrikar has done for party workers is no longer the scenario today.
Mahesh Gaokar said that the party should first find out how the five councillors were elected in the responsibility given to the general party workers against the Phaldesai, who lost all the three seats.
Many prominent party workers from the constituency including Sadanand Gawde, Prashant Gaokar, Sudesh Bhandari, Chandrakant Gaokar, Santosh Gaokar, Janu Zore, Anand Naik and Dilip Pauskar were present at the press conference.
